I was in the gifted program in grade school and junior high, it was an awesome experience. (US Midwest)
Three points.
1. Not all kids are gifted in all areas so usually we were in a mix of gifted and non-gifted classes.
2. It's important to interact with all levels/types of kids and there are experiences at school outside of classes.
3. It makes it feel more special that you get to go to certain classes/do special things and events that not everyone is in.
Keep it as a program inside the school.
